Output 052589013d81f5b3049fb62468b3552fc06f16fa397eda23dd4977ac7e1822fa:2

value
115850
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c947b5b6e93d6f48cb1b9ef931a5e0f5b69f1a8 OP_EQUAL
address
3MoLTStgKADJrc92bqsCT3iFCQR9GzBDLo
transaction
052589013d81f5b3049fb62468b3552fc06f16fa397eda23dd4977ac7e1822fa
spent
true